This is serious mate you need to deal with it.  Write down what he does, day - time - conversation (both sides) etc.  Especially if you've just had an op you can sue the company if they take no action on bullying as it causes undue stress.

There is a guy in our Head Office who likes to push people to get things done.  You don't mind if they're nice about it but this guy is a complete pleb.  So…. I've had two runnings with him.  The first one I wrote down the time and date and what was said and e-mailed his boss and mine (the guy is a manager I'm not).  I was very precise and basically said that I would not take his abuse and comments especially coming from a manager who I do not report to.  They sorted it out amongst themselves…. the guy steered clear of me for a while but when I said I could not facilitate his out of hours work (he told me 2 hours before he wanted me to stay late) he was seemingly shouting and cursing my name in Head Office.  I'm a real team player so people in Head Office called me to inform me.

Again I wrote down what the witnesses said, what I said in our conversation and what he said in our conversation.  I got a hold of the old e-mail and forwarded it (along with our new conversation and witness comments) to his boss, him and my boss.  I said that this is now two occasions I have dealt with this abuse in a professional manner but it was becoming bullying and I wanted it dealt with.  If they did not deal with it I would be seeking advice on how to stop the abuse and also be seeking information on why the company would allow or condone such bullying behaviour of it's employees.

It kicked up a poop storm, the guy called me holding back tears and said he should have given me at least a weeks notice, how sorry he was and that his enthusiasm comes over as aggression and he's working on it blah, blah…. I accepted his apology.  I sent out a further e-mail to the three of them (including the e-mail trail) stating that I accept the apology but this does not mean I accept the behaviour.  I urged the bloke to be more understanding and professional if he wants me to help him.  He is still an idiot to others but gives me such a wide birth now it verges on being cringe-worthy.
